Position Overview

Aecon-EAC Highway 8 General Partnership (“AEGP8”), a 50/50 consortium between Aecon and Emil Anderson Construction, has been selected by the Province of British Columbia to deliver the Highway 8 Project under a progressive alliance contract model. AEGP8 will work as an integrated team with the province during a development phase to finalize the design, scope and target cost of the project, with construction expected to commence in the second quarter of 2025 and completion expected in late 2026. The scope of work includes replacing two temporary structures with permanent bridges and building approximately 3 kilometres of connecting highway approximately 15 kilometres east of Spences Bridge to improve safety and climate resiliency.

What You’ll Do Here:

  • Meets daily with project crews to review production schedule and confirm all materials, equipment and resources are readily available for production to continue on schedule and within budget.
  • Collects, coordinates and analyzes shop drawings, design specifications, material requirements and project data through the duration of the project to ensure quality and contract specification compliance.
  • Provides technical input for project work plan and scheduling. Identifying risk elements of production, materials, equipment or process that could negatively impact the budget or schedule.
  • Evaluates daily production, schedule and budget projections to accurately track project performance. Documents daily activities in Company approved methods and technologies.
  • Notifies team members and manager of any significant schedule changes and recommends solutions for management consideration.
  • Remits accurate project quantity input and controls using assigned project cost coding to ensure project financials are accurately reported. Manages cost coding with Company finance and accounting teams regarding employee time, materials, equipment and subcontractor needs.
  • Reviews project specifications for quality assurance at the beginning of work, during the project work and after work completes. Initiates and manages appropriate certificates, inspections and other documentation regarding construction production on the project site.
  • Works with construction crews and engineering leaders to plan field layout on the project site, ensuring appropriate utility and commercial lines are marked before production begins. Initiates and manages any permits needed before work can begin.
  • Prepare monthly cost projections using information generated from project management systems and prepare quarterly cash flow projections.
  • Examine/inspect field conditions and identify problems, inaccuracies, and cost saving measures that arise and take corrective actions as needed.
  • Coordinates subcontractor work methods, schedule and crews as needed.
  • Reconciles job close-out checklist with owner representative and field crews at the end of the project.
  • Provide mentoring and coaching to junior engineering staff and technical employees.
  • Performs other duties and responsibilities as required.
